Hope someone can help me with this. I'm having a strange issue with my ipad and itunes, when I try to update an app I keep getting a "Cannot connect to itunes store" notice, but I have no problem downloading new apps or browsing the app store.

It's as if I'm being blocked from the update section of the itunes store. I have a wifi only ipad so I'm updating over my wifi network. The other thing is that my iphone can update apps with no issue over the wifi network, it's just the ipad that can't. Any ideas?

The problem seemed to come out of nowhere. Thanks for any help

Try Deleting that particular app from your ipad and reinstall. probably a corrupt or incomplete update.

you can also try to sign out of itunes from the settings and then sign in back again!

and try restarting your ipad and then sync with itunes.
